"Xiaoqi?" Chu Jinnan, Chu Qianli’s elder brother, the Grand Tutor’s eldest son.

Because his mother was of humble origin, and he himself was known for his straightforward character, he never really got along with the calculating Grand Tutor.

The Grand Tutor had never liked him and had found an excuse a few years ago to send him off to a border assignment.

He had been gone for many years, and if it were not for Chu Qianli’s previous plea to the emperor to call him back, he would not know when he could return to his own home.

"Elder brother..." Although he was not her biological elder brother, she had gotten used to calling him that, so she continued to do so.

At least, tonight, he was still her brother.

"Are you also here to see Grandfather?"

Chu Jinnan nodded, "Grandfather’s health hasn’t fully recovered, and he needs his medicine changed twice every night."

"You are personally changing Grandfather’s medicine?" Chu Qianli was somewhat surprised.

Such tasks could be left to the servants, there was no need for him to do it himself.

Chu Jinnan had just been reassigned, and probably hadn’t yet adapted to his new post; there must be many matters requiring his attention.

"Didn’t they say someone in the residence was poisoning Grandfather? I think it’s safer to administer the medicine myself."

"That’s good, then, it also puts my mind at ease."

Chu Qianli nodded and accompanied him into the Duke’s room.

Upon seeing Chu Qianli, Chu Buqu was somewhat excited, "Xiaoqi, how come you didn’t let me know in advance when you’d be back? It’s so late, did someone from the Prince Residence escort you here?"

Not wanting to worry him, Chu Qianli had no choice but to nod, "Yes, I’ll be leaving in a moment; I need to rush back."

"Xiaoqi is always so busy," sighed Chu Buqu, waving her over, "Come here, let Grandfather have a good look at you. It’s been a while, and my Xiaoqi has gotten thinner."

Chu Qianli suddenly felt a twinge in her nose and barely held back tears.

He was no longer her biological grandfather.

But the affection was still there.

"Grandfather, it’s been a long time since I’ve given you a massage. Let me massage you a bit, okay?"

She did not know how long she would be going to Longteng Country this time, nor did she know if she would have the opportunity to return.

Before leaving, she only wished to fulfill her filial duties again.

Even if she was not his true granddaughter, in her heart, he was always her Grandfather.

After taking his medicine, the Duke soon fell asleep under Chu Qianli’s massage.

Once he was soundly asleep and she had covered him with a blanket, Chu Qianli quietly left his bedroom.

Chu Jinnan was still waiting outside in the courtyard.

When Chu Qianli came out, Chu Jinnan approached her, then suddenly knelt on one knee.

"Elder brother..."

"Thank you for your righteous assistance! Xiaoqi, your brother owes you, and I will surely repay you in the future!"

"No need, my bringing you back was also because I believed that only you could stand the Duke Residence back up."

The Grand Tutor truly wasn’t up to the task; he lacked such capability.

"Elder brother, I’ve helped you as much as I can; the rest will be up to you. And Grandfather, he’s relying on you now."

"Xiaoqi..." Chu Jinnan looked at her, his emotions complicated.

Why did he always feel as if Xiaoqi, once she left this time, would never return?

"Elder brother, there are still people in the residence who wish Grandfather harm. Just because Chu Huaiyu’s affair has concluded doesn’t mean everything else has ended."

So seeing Chu Jinnan taking care of Grandfather personally tonight, she could finally rest easy.

Chu Qianli helped him up.

She looked up at Chu Jinnan, who stood a whole head taller than her, and said earnestly, "If you want to not be bullied, you must first become stronger yourself. Elder brother, you’ll have to make an effort to continue on your own path from now on."

"I understand," he replied.

Chu Qianli gave him a smile, with no more words to say.

Elder brother was older than her, and had been through no fewer experiences.

He would know what to do.

"I really have to go." She would set off tomorrow, and tonight, she could not afford to waste too much time.

She still had to go back and continue preparing.

"Big brother will see you off."

Chu Jinnan escorted her to the back door, knowing she had come on her own, but he could also tell that Xiaoqi’s martial arts skills were not weak, even surpassing his own.

"Xiaoqi," Chu Jinnan couldn’t help but ask as they were parting, "will you... come back?"

That feeling, that she would never return, grew stronger and stronger.

The brother-sister affection between the two of them had not been strong before, but for some reason, tonight, it felt particularly difficult to let go.

Chu Qianli nodded, then shook her head, "I don’t know."

Chu Jinnan’s heart clenched.

In the end, he could only sigh softly and looked at her earnestly, "No matter what, if there’s anything you need in the future, as long as I can do it, I will give it my all!"

"Good! I’ll remember what you said, big brother."

Chu Qianli gave him a fist salute, "Big brother, may we meet again!"

"Take care!"

Leaving the Duke Residence, Chu Qianli did not hurry on her way.

Her mood was as heavy as her footsteps.

This time, she was truly leaving the Duke Residence for good.

This home would no longer belong to her.

After leaving the Duke Residence and walking for a while, Chu Qianli gradually noticed that something was off about the atmosphere around her.

It wasn’t too late yet; as she walked on the streets, they were still somewhat bustling.

The person following her definitely intended to let her know they were there.

Otherwise, with her profound Inner Strength, Chu Qianli felt sure she would not have been able to detect their presence.

When she came to a teahouse, Chu Qianli suddenly stopped.

Turning around, she looked at the pitch-black night sky, "Would you like to come in for a drink?"

Those around her looked at the young girl with surprise.

How was she communicating with the air?

There wasn’t a soul behind her.

Yet only Chu Qianli could hear the voice from behind her, "If you’re not afraid of dying, take a trip to Huaishan Temple."

Chu Qianli looked up and saw that Huaishan Temple was not far away.

She was not fearless of death, but she had too many questions!

Eventually, she took a step toward the temple across the lake.

Consort Yu sat on the highest railing of Huaishan Temple.

From a distance, her slender figure rested on the railings, looking as if she might fall at any moment.

But such a master surely faced no danger at all.

Chu Qianli climbed up the stairs and stopped not far behind her, "What do you want with me?"

"You truly aren’t afraid of death," Murong Yu remarked coldly without turning to look at her.

"You won’t kill me," Chu Qianli stated calmly.

"Based on what do you say that?" Murong Yu raised an eyebrow.

"If you wanted to kill me, why go through all the trouble of applying the Soul Captivating Technique on me?"

Consort Yu wanted her to stay by Feng Wuya’s side, to protect Wuya.

In truth, even if she hadn’t applied the Soul Captivating Technique on her, Chu Qianli would have fought with her life to protect Feng Wuya.

Why go to such lengths?

Unexpectedly, Murong Yu turned around and gave her a smile, "Do you think I only used the Soul Captivating Technique on you?"
